Fr Timothy Radcliffe OP is a Dominican friar and former Master of the worldwide Dominican order. He is based at Blackfriars
in Oxford and is the author of several books as well as a popular lecturer and retreat giver. 

Prof. Thomas O’Loughlin is Professor of Historical Theology at the University of Nottingham. His most recent book is Eating Together,
Becoming One: Taking Up Pope Francis's Call to Theologians
, published in March 2020 by the Liturgical Press.

 

Dr Gemma Simmonds CJ is Director of the Religious Life Institute at the Margaret Beaufort Institute of Theology. She is a sister of the Congregation of Jesus and a frequent contributor to the BBC and other media.

 


Dr Natalie K. Watson is a theologian, writer and editor based in Peterborough. She is the author of several books and articles on contemporary theology and the Publishing Editor of the Pastoral Review.
